Attila The Stockbroker : The Arthouse, Southampton 17-11-2022
John Baine AKA Attila The Stockbroker has been plying his commerce as a efficiency Poet, musician and songwriter for 4 many years now and in 2022, with the Covid Lockdown behind us, he reveals no indicators of letting up both on the stay or recording fronts. A part of the unique ‘Rock In opposition to Racism’ technology and impressed as a younger pupil by Pink Saunders well-known ‘name to arms’ music press letter, Baine has continued to take his Socialist-inspired poetry to the individuals ever since and is quick approaching real Nationwide Treasure standing, says Richard Chorley. Or shouldn’t that be ‘Nationalised Treasure’?
A wintery Friday night time in downtown Southampton discovered Attila on high type within the cool, intimate setting which is town’s ‘Arthouse’ venue, positioned within the now designated central ‘Arts quarter’. The Arthouse is a terrific venue which has battled admirably towards all odds to remain open and bless Southampton with a wealthy and vital cultural power, utilising gigs and occasions that includes each nationally and domestically famend artists. It’s been going for a great few years now and the latest refurbishment has reworked the vibe from a conventional English model ‘different cafe’, (considerably of a dichotomy in that description!) to one thing extra akin with a hip, Decrease East Aspect gathering place ambiance.
The artists now carry out immediately at avenue degree, reasonably than the earlier first ground setting and its laborious to think about a venue whereby the viewers might get any nearer to the motion. This works a deal with and likewise ensures that poets with audio ranges like Attila, don’t want to make use of any microphones or amplification. Tonight he relishes within the shut proximity as he fires by renditions of his best work and we’re handled to heartfelt variations of poems touching Abervan, the Thatcher years, the rise of latest neo-Fascism as embodied in Farage and UKIP, the affect of Lockdown on romantic relationship’s (Attila’s musings devoted to his spouse on this topic are notably touching) and way more.
These are augmented with songs and an attractive style of the dub poetry embodied on his new album. It’s a superb physique of labor with Attila in full movement over a collection of very good Dub Reggae backings, constructed by the Producer Kingsley Salmon. Within the tight confines of the Arthouse, he depends on a tiny hand-held speaker that tasks damned spectacular musical accompaniment of the tracks, which lately obtained crucial acclaim from Baine’s long-term poetic compadre Benjamin Zephaniah.
Previous to the present, which is obtained with passionate enthusiasm by a choose viewers of round 40 who’re actually crammed into the viewing space, I interview Baine, who displays nice relish at being again on the street in each Britain and Europe. True to character, he pulls no punches in his evaluation of elements like Brexit and its affect on musicians, notably those that depend on the European radical circuit.
All in all, it’s a terrific night within the firm of one among Britain’s nice dwelling Poet’s who combines his ardour for Socialism with an astute sense of ‘Everyman’ model relevance
and a splendidly tuned and endearing wit. He could have been going for 40 years, however the Stockbroker is not any relic of a bygone age both. Of all the unique Punk period performers, Attila has embraced the ability of social media impressively, not merely through recitals and efficiency of his materials to hundreds of his web page members, however by staging virtually day by day elongated political debates which are a magnet for large contribution ranges from his fanbase. Tonight in becoming acknowledgement of his – and The Arthouse’s embrace of latest technological instruments – the efficiency is streamed ‘stay’ to an prolonged viewers watching at house. That’s not fairly the identical as being up this near a novel performer who has now mastered his artwork beautifully, however I’m positive all these partook, really cherished the expertise.
Viva Attila, lengthy could he rant!
